...It feels like a completely different car - it pulls like a train all the way to the redline (I keep hitting the limiter accidentially!). Now the car actually feels fast, felt so strangled before!

This is on a UK99, SS BB and Magnex centre, with Forge VTA DV, K&N 57i induction.

It was nice and warm today so got a few pops - not as much as I would have liked - and certainly not that loud - can these be made louder somehow? ECU mapping?

Highly recommended to anyone!
